Ethiopia holds national conference on sustainable transition

Prime Minister Abiy Ahmed attended the national conference that reviewed Ethiopia's achievements and laid groundwork for future generations.

Addis Ababa hosted the Ethiopia Is Being Built national conference on June 23, 2018 E.C. under the theme From Change to Sustainable Transition.

Prime Minister Abiy Ahmed attended the gathering that examined achievements across agriculture, industry, tourism, mining and ICT sectors over recent years.

Wheat exports have begun and milk production exceeded 16 billion liters in the first nine months. The Green Legacy program has planted over 48 billion seedlings.
